Kalliope is a planet in the Sagittarius arm section of the Golden Branch controlled by OriCon. Kalliope is seismically unstable, with lots of earthquakes, and the population numbers in the tens of thousands.

It's "Space LA", with many genetically or physically altered people and a vibrant fashion culture. These alterations originally started with far-reaching genetic experiments done by Fairchild Research and Development. These experiments were meant to create people better adapted for Kalliope's many earthquakes, and focused on things such as improving eyesight, reflexes and survivability, only later evolving into both more aesthetic- and combat-oriented fields.

The earliest examples of these genetic procedures were forced on the native population of the planet, and the few that survived were pushed off-world as the image of Kalliope changed over time. Some of these rat people would go on to form the Odamas Fleet, a group of space pirates and cast-offs determined to reclaim their home.

Around the time of the September Incident, Kalliope is re-taken by the Odamas Fleet.

After a broad failure to unify during the war against Rigour, the many resulting losses eventually convinced the independent planets in the Golden Branch, including Kalliope, to unify under Gemm, creating the Free States of Gemm.
